Biochemical engineering has wide-ranging applications, including the industrial production of enzymes, vaccines, antibiotics, and biofuels; environmental protection through wastewater treatment and bioremediation; and fermentation processes in the food and beverage industry.
Biochemical Oxygen Demand (BOD) measures the amount of oxygen consumed by biochemical reactions in water, serving as an indicator of organic pollutant levels. For example, sewage discharge can raise BOD, reducing oxygen availability and harming aquatic life. Biochemical engineers use biochemical techniques and treatment processes to reduce BOD, ensuring safer water ecosystems and supporting environmental sustainability.
Biochemical engineering focuses on applying biochemical reactions and techniques for industrial-scale production of biological products. In contrast, biomedical engineering combines engineering principles with medical sciences, concentrating on designing medical devices, diagnostic tools, and therapies. While biochemical engineering emphasizes industrial bio-product production, biomedical engineering aims to improve healthcare outcomes through technology.
Biochemical engineering is a branch of engineering that emerged in the 1980s, focusing on the large-scale production of biochemical products. It integrates principles from biology, chemistry, and engineering to study biochemical reactions and techniques. This field investigates intracellular components such as proteins, sugars, lipids, and nucleic acids, which are essential for producing various biological substances, including enzymes, vaccines, and biofuels.
